高阶 组件react个人

阿里云 Docker 部署个人博客全过程记录

Dockers安装 新手可以去阿里云免费试用一个月云服务器,建议按照阿里文档部署,CentOS可以参考这个 https://help.aliyun.com/document_detail/187598.html 查看本机内核版本,内核版本需高于 3.10 uname -r 运行以下命令,安装dnf ......
全过程 Docker 个人 博客

vue 软键盘组件封装

场景和需求 1 软键盘固定 2 多输入框共用一个组件,聚焦切换时操作对象自动切换 3 根据光标在输入框的位置进行相应的输入和删除操作 4 点击软键盘时保存输入框光标活跃 5 输入框和键盘在一个弹窗组件中,弹窗打开时对其中一个输入框默认聚焦 6 样式方面,按键宽度自适应,可以给特定按键特定样式。 7 ......
组件 键盘 vue

react生命周期

componentWillMount:16版本就废弃了,相当于Vue中created; componentDidMount: 会在组件挂载后(插入DOM中)立即调用;相当于Vue中的onMounted; componentDidUpdate(prevProps, prevState, snapsho ......
周期 生命 react

第四部分:Spdlog日志库的核心组件分析-logger

Spdlog是一个快速且可扩展的C++日志库,它支持多线程和异步日志记录。在本文中,我们将分析Spdlog日志库的核心代码,探究其实现原理和代码结构。 Spdlog的基本架构 上一篇文章介绍了spdlog的五个主要组件,其中最重要是Logger、Sink和Formatter其中,Logger负责日志 ......
组件 核心 部分 Spdlog logger

Android开发-Android常用组件-Button按钮

4.3 Button(按钮) Button控件继承TextView ,拥有TextView的属性。 StateListDrawable简介 StateListDrawable是Drawable资源的一种,可以根据不同的状态,设置不同的图片效果,关键节点<selector>,我们只需要将Button的 ......
Android 组件 按钮 常用 Button

万字血书React—走近React

配置开发环境 脚手架工具create-react-app 储备知识:终端或命令行、代码编辑器 React官方中文文档 create-react-app 其是基于Node的快速搭建React项目的脚手架工具。 npx create-react-app testdemo cd testdemo npm ......
血书 React

Vue子组件向父组件传值(this.$emit()方法)

子组件使用this.$emit()向父组件传值 首先必须在父组件中引用子组件,然后实现传值 第一步在父组件中引入子组件 import UnitByPurchaseAddOrUpdate from '@views/modules/matter/UnitByPurchaseAddOrUpdate' 声明 ......
组件 方法 this emit Vue

react根据antd下拉框监听事件带出表单输入框值

// 招待费根据招待人数,陪同人数,人均标准自动带出申请金额 peopleChange = (value,field) => { const {form} = this.props if (value null) { form.setFieldsValue({amount: 0}) return } ......
表单 事件 react antd

ExtJS如何进行组件间通信

在 ExtJS 中,组件间通信可以使用多种方式进行,下面介绍一些常用的方法: 1、事件监听:组件可以通过监听其他组件的事件来进行通信。例如,一个按钮组件可以监听一个表单组件的提交事件,当表单提交时,按钮组件可以执行相应的操作。 2、发布订阅模式:组件可以通过发布事件的方式来通知其他组件进行相应的操作 ......
组件 ExtJS

VueJS如何进行组件间通信

VueJS 组件间通信有多种方式,以下是其中几种: 1、父组件向子组件传值:使用 props 属性,父组件将数据作为 props 传递给子组件,子组件在 props 中声明接收数据,并通过 this.$props 访问。 2、子组件向父组件传值:使用 $emit 触发自定义事件,子组件通过 $emi ......
组件 VueJS

第八章 工程化 - 实例体验 - 基于 vue框架 开发一个完整的组件库 二

基础 Monorepo 环境建设 包名选择与注册 1、给 组件库 命名 => 最终会发布到 npm.js 仓库 2、查看 组件库 的命名是否可注册方法 npm view package-name version 如: npm view caix version => 返回 code E404 【 未 ......
组件 框架 实例 工程 vue

第七章 工程化 - 实例体验 - 基于 vue框架 开发一个完整的组件库 一

基于 vue 框架 开发一个完整的组件库来体验前端工程化的魅力 对一个组件库的开发来全面认识熟悉 前端工程化 的配置,系统的理解工程化中各个工具所起到的作用,并且将其最终可以应用到你的团队当中去,真正的实现工程化的价值,帮助你的团队提效,实现作为前端工程师的价值 基于 vue 框架 开发一个完整的组 ......
组件 框架 实例 工程 vue

vue全家桶进阶之路21:Vue Loader 打包单位件组件

Vue Loader 是一个 webpack 插件,它允许在单个文件中定义 Vue 组件,并将其包装为 CommonJS 模块,以便在应用程序中使用。使用 Vue Loader 打包的组件被称为单文件组件(Single File Components,SFCs),因为它们将 HTML、CSS 和 J ......
全家 组件 单位 Loader vue

七月 个人测试架构体系

本文为CSDN博主「七月灬」 总结的非常好原文链接:https://blog.csdn.net/u014220762/article/details/102660984 个人测试架构体系软件测试全流程 健全的测试流程有助于规范测试各阶段活动的进行。本文主要描述测试全流程中各阶段活动的出入口条件、工作 ......
架构 体系 个人

libx11遍历窗体上所有组件

libx11遍历窗体上所有组件 ANSWER 想要遍历窗体上的所有组件,需要先获取窗体的ID,然后通过XQueryTree函数来获取窗体的子组件ID列表。可以通过以下步骤来实现: 获取窗体ID:可以使用XGetInputFocus函数获取当前焦点所在的窗体ID,或者使用XQueryTree函数遍历整 ......
窗体 组件 libx 11

Element-UI el-upload组件,上传失败,但是依然显示文件列表

问题描述 最近在使用element-ui的 el-upload组件,发现一个问题,就是我在上传文件过程中,上传失败了,文件列表仍然展示该文件。 ##解决办法 上传成功on-success回调方法中 // 除去上传失败的文件 refName为绑定的upload ref值 const errFileIn ......
Element-UI 组件 el-upload Element 文件

《渗透测试》信息打点-语言框架&开发组件&FastJson&Shiro&Log4j&SpringBoot 2023 Day17

1 框架:简单代码的一个整合库,如果使用框架就只需要学习使用框架调用即可 如:文件上传功能是需要很多代码来实现的,框架把这个代码进行封封装,调用即可 影响:如果采用框架开发,代码的安全性是取决于框架的过滤机制 2 组件:第三方的功能模块(日志记录,数据监控,数据转换等) Web架构: 1、最简单最入 ......
amp SpringBoot 组件 框架 FastJson

动态组件

动态组件 动态组件:动态切换组件的显示与隐藏 通过两个按钮,进行Left和Right两个组件的切换 通过keep-alive include和exclude进行组件的选择缓存还是不缓存 而keep-alive有对应的生命周期activated、deactivated 步骤 普通的导入后,再加入 组件 ......
组件 动态

组件之间的数据共享

组件之间的数据共享: 一、父组件传递给子组件 ①App.vue template 给子组件绑定值 <Left :msg="message" :user="userinfo"></Left> script 声明需要发送的数据 data() { return{ message: "hello,这是来自父 ......
组件 之间 数据

python apscheduler 定时任务的基本使用-1-概念及组件构成

python apscheduler 定时任务的基本使用-1-概念及组件构成 1、前言 我们需要执行定时任务,可以使用apscheduler这个框架,选择它的原因,是网上都说常用的就是这个。随大流嘛!官方文档 2、下载 python -m pip install -i https://pypi.tu ......
apscheduler 组件 任务 python

【ArkTS】一文带你了解Swiper组件的方方面面

​ 【关键字】 ArkTS、Swiper组件、SwiperController、轮播图 【Swiper是什么】 Swiper是一个容器类组件,它提供了切换页面显示的能力,Swiper内部包含的每一个子组件都表示一个页面,简单来说就是如果Swiper中包含了3个子组件,那么Swiper中就有3个页面。 ......
方方面面 方方 组件 Swiper ArkTS

界面控件DevExpress WinForms的数据网格组件——更轻松地管理业务数据(二)

DevExpress WinForms控件的Data Grid组件是一个性能优异的编辑/数据整型组件,附带了数十个高影响力的功能,用户可以轻松地管理信息并根据业务需求来展示数据信息。在上文中(点击这里回顾>>),我们为大家介绍了网格组件的性能优势、灵活的视图等,接下来我们将继续介绍网格数据的编辑、条 ......
数据 网格 控件 DevExpress 组件

[GPT] 提高个人网站的访问量的 30 种详细方式

内容优化:提高网站的质量和价值,让用户喜欢并分享你的内容。 SEO优化:通过关键词优化、网站结构优化等方式,提高搜索引擎排名。 社交媒体:在社交媒体上分享你的内容,吸引更多人来访问你的网站。 广告投放:在适当的时候投放广告,以提高网站的知名度和曝光率。 网站速度优化:加快网站的加载速度,提高用户体验 ......
个人网站 访问量 方式 个人 网站

14.Header组件静态搭建 + jsonp

Header组件这里的标题下的图案实现为关键,实现如下: /components/header/index.jsx文件内容如下: /* 头部导航组件 */ import React, { Component} from "react"; import './index.css' export def ......
静态 组件 Header jsonp 14

React Hook 中 useState 异步回调获取不到最新值及解决方案

预先了解 setState 的两种传参方式 1、直接传入新值 setState(options); 列如: const [state, setState] = useState(0); setState(state + 1); 2、传入回调函数 setState(callBack); 例如: con ......
useState 解决方案 方案 React Hook

vue组件化开发---插槽的使用

插槽基本介绍 在开发中,我们会经常封装一个个可复用的组件: 前面我们会通过props传递给组件一些数据,让组件来进行展示; 但是为了让这个组件具备更强的通用性,我们不能将组件中的内容限制为固定的div、span等等这些元素; 比如某种情况下我们使用组件,希望组件显示的是一个按钮,某种情况下我们使用组 ......
组件 vue

uniapp getCurrentPages()回塞数据 回塞到页面组件里解决方法

//数据展示页 <lab ref="thridRef" confirm="sumbitFn"></lab> const thridRef = ref() //数据展示页引用的组件 lab.vue //抛出需要被塞数据的字段 defineExpose({form}) //回塞数据页 var pages ......
getCurrentPages 组件 页面 方法 数据

自定义函数式弹框组件

以vue3 为例 import { createApp } from "vue"; import messageBox from './messageBox.vue' // 弹框组件 export function showMsgToast(title='', content, option = { ......
函数 组件

开源: golang+vue的论坛 和 node+react的IM系统

最近基于开源做了两个自己系统 都是UI非常好看的 我将两个系统的数据互通了 附带了一些产品思考 只需要一个邮箱就可以登录 无密码 无手机号 尽量简化流程 第一个论坛 站点 https://bulita.cn 现在主要是聚合招聘信息 目标是尽可能降低招聘和求职的门槛 以上海和远程工作为主 开源地址 h ......
golang 系统 react 论坛 node

react useMemoParamsFn

import {useCallback, useRef} from 'react'; import {shallowEqual} from "../utils/shallow-equals"; function useMemoParamsFn(fn: any) { const preParamsRe ......
useMemoParamsFn react